On Friday, April 26, the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) once and for all denied a 2014 petition filed by the Center for Biological Diversity (CBD) to list discarded polyvinyl chloride (PVC) as a hazardous waste under the Resource Conservation and Recovery Act (RCRA). 51风流 has previously reported on this issue when 51风流 submitted comments to the EPA, and when there was a tentative ruling from EPA siding with 51风流. This win comes in a large part thanks to the nearly 2,000 51风流 members who took action and encouraged EPA not to move forward with regulating PVC.

On April 29, 2024, Senate and House of Representatives leaders reached an agreement to reauthorize Federal Aviation Administration funding for the next five years. Previously, the House passed their version of the bill in July 2023, but the Senate was held up due to debates about increasing the pilot retirement age, including flight simulators in qualifying as a portion of flight training, and providing special security at airports for certain members of Congress and other officials.

According to the latest Contractor Compensation Quarterly (CCQ) published by PAS, Inc., construction executive staff wage increases came in at 5.6% for 2023 and are also projected to rise by an average 4.7% by 2024 year-end. The actual 2023 increase compared to the 2023 projected increase was .9% higher, so it is possible we will see this same trend in 2024 (or not 鈥 see below). For comparison, WorldatWork is projecting a 4.1% average increase for all executives in 2024.
